最小権限の原則(最小特権の原則)とは、情報システムにおけるアクセス権限の管理に関する重要な原則です。
この原則は、システム利用者やプログラムに対して、目的に必要な最低限の権限だけを与えることを推奨しています。
これにより、障害や不正アクセスのリスクを最小限に抑えることが可能になります。
本記事では、最小権限の原則の定義、実践方法、そしてその重要性について詳しく説明します。
最小権限の原則の基本概念
最小権限の原則とは?
最小権限の原則は、オペレーティングシステム(OS)のセキュリティ機能を利用して、ユーザーやプログラム、接続デバイスに対して、目的に必要な最低限の権限のみを与える運用方針を指します。
この原則に従うことで、誤操作や不正アクセスのリスクを減少させることができます。
実践例
例えば、データの保存や書き換えを行わないプログラムには、ファイルやディレクトリの読み取り権限のみを付与します。
また、一般ユーザーのアカウントからはシステム設定の変更やソフトウェアのインストールを禁止することが求められます。
これにより、システムの挙動を変更することができなくなります。
最小権限の原則の利点
1. セキュリティの向上
最小権限の原則を適用することで、誤操作やソフトウェアの欠陥によるシステム異常を防止し、不正アクセスやマルウェア感染などの外部攻撃からシステムを保護することができます。
2. 被害の抑制
不正アクセスや記録の改竄、機密情報の漏洩といった攻撃が発生した場合でも、あらかじめ設定された権限の範囲内でしか操作できないため、被害を最小限に抑えることが可能です。
3. コンプライアンスの確保
多くの業界では、データの保護に関する法律や規制が存在します。
最小権限の原則を実施することで、これらの法律に準拠しやすくなり、企業の信頼性を向上させます。
最小権限の原則の実施方法
1. アクセス権の定期的な見直し
システム内のユーザーやプログラムのアクセス権限を定期的に見直し、必要に応じて調整することが重要です。
これにより、権限が過剰に付与されることを防ぎます。
2. 最小権限の教育
従業員に対して最小権限の原則について教育を行い、システムの利用において必要以上の権限を求めないようにする意識を高めることが求められます。
3. 技術的な対策の導入
アクセス管理システムや監視ツールを導入し、権限の管理やログの監視を行うことで、実践的なセキュリティ対策を強化します。
まとめ
最小権限の原則(PoLP)は、情報システムのセキュリティを強化するための基本的な原則であり、ユーザーやプログラムに対して必要最低限の権限を付与することによって、リスクを最小化することが可能です。
適切にこの原則を実施することで、システムの安定性や安全性を向上させることができます。
企業や組織において、最小権限の原則を理解し、実行することがますます重要となっています。
さらに参考してください。